Job description

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Senior Electrical Analytical Engineer specializing in Electromagnetic Transient (EMT) analysis of power systems.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in performing complex calculations related to Transient Over-Voltage (TOV), Transient Recovery Voltage (TRV), Switching Studies, and Insulation Coordination. Additionally, the candidate should possess extensive software proficiency in PSCAD or EMTP-RV.

Responsibilities :

  • Conduct detailed electrical analysis utilizing time domain techniques to evaluate system performance and identify potential issues.
  • Perform complex calculations related to Transient Over-Voltage (TOV), Transient Recovery Voltage (TRV), Switching Studies, and Insulation Coordination.
  • Develop and implement innovative solutions to optimize system performance and mitigate risks.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to provide technical expertise and support in electrical analysis and troubleshooting.
  • Prepare comprehensive reports documenting analysis findings, recommendations, and design modifications.
  • Stay updated with industry trends, regulations, and emerging technologies relevant to time domain analysis.

This position allows for a flexible hybrid schedule with a mix of in-office days and working remotely.

Qualifications

We do not sponsor employees for work authorization in the U.S. for this position.

Requirements :

  • A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ering (background in Power / Power Systems) and sufficient industry experience is considered in lieu of an advanced degree. Master's or PhD in Electrical Engineering is preferred.
  • 5 or more years of experience in time domain analysis of power systems.
  • Proficiency in utilizing software tools such as PSCAD or EMTP-RV to perform complex electrical calculations.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to identify and resolve complex technical issues.
  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, with the ability to effectively present technical information to non-technical stakeholders.
  •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and meet project deadlines.
